Keeper Security has introduced a significant upgrade to its platform with the launch of KeeperDB, bringing zero-trust database access directly into its privileged access management (PAM) solution. Announced at the RSA Conference 2026, the new capability is designed to tackle one of the most persistent security gaps in enterprises—how database credentials are managed and protected.
In many organizations, database credentials are still scattered across spreadsheets, configuration files, and developer environments, creating a high-risk attack surface. KeeperDB changes this by allowing users to connect to databases like MySQL, PostgreSQL, Oracle, and Microsoft SQL Server directly from the Keeper Vault. This removes the need to expose credentials in plaintext or rely on disconnected tools, while ensuring all access is governed by centralized policies and recorded for auditing purposes.
What makes this approach particularly impactful is its alignment with zero-trust principles. Credentials are never revealed to users, access is granted based on strict role-based controls, and every session is monitored. By consolidating database access into the same secure vault that already manages passwords, API keys, and privileged sessions, Keeper aims to eliminate credential sprawl and simplify compliance with standards like SOC 2 and HIPAA.
Understanding that teams often rely on familiar tools, Keeper is also introducing a proxy feature that allows developers to continue using existing database clients while routing connections through its secure infrastructure. This ensures organizations can strengthen security without disrupting established workflows, a key factor in driving adoption across enterprise environments.
KeeperDB is part of a broader strategy to unify multiple security functions into a single platform. Instead of juggling separate tools for secrets management, remote access, and privileged sessions, organizations can operate under one system with a single credential store and policy engine. This mirrors a wider industry trend, with competitors like CyberArk, BeyondTrust, and Delinea also expanding their PAM capabilities.
